diff --git a/contrib/compiler-rt/lib/divdc3.c b/contrib/compiler-rt/lib/divdc3.c new file mode 100644 index 0000000..c96aefd --- /dev/null +++ b/contrib/compiler-rt/lib/divdc3.c @@ -0,0 +1,59 @@ +/* ===-- divdc3.c - Implement __divdc3 -------------------------------------=== + * + * The LLVM Compiler Infrastructure + * + * This file is distributed under the University of Illinois Open Source + * License. See LICENSE.TXT for details. + * + * ===----------------------------------------------------------------------=== + * + * This file implements __divdc3 for the compiler_rt library. + * + * ===----------------------------------------------------------------------=== + */ + +#include "int_lib.h" +#include <math.h> +#include <complex.h> + +/* Returns: the quotient of (a + ib) / (c + id) */ + +double _Complex +__divdc3(double __a, double __b, double __c, double __d) +{ + int __ilogbw = 0; + double __logbw = logb(fmax(fabs(__c), fabs(__d))); + if (isfinite(__logbw)) + { + __ilogbw = (int)__logbw; + __c = scalbn(__c, -__ilogbw); + __d = scalbn(__d, -__ilogbw); + } + double __denom = __c * __c + __d * __d; + double _Complex z; + __real__ z = scalbn((__a * __c + __b * __d) / __denom, -__ilogbw); + __imag__ z = scalbn((__b * __c - __a * __d) / __denom, -__ilogbw); + if (isnan(__real__ z) && isnan(__imag__ z)) + { + if ((__denom == 0.0) && (!isnan(__a) || !isnan(__b))) + { + __real__ z = copysign(INFINITY, __c) * __a; + __imag__ z = copysign(INFINITY, __c) * __b; + } + else if ((isinf(__a) || isinf(__b)) && isfinite(__c) && isfinite(__d)) + { + __a = copysign(isinf(__a) ? 1.0 : 0.0, __a); + __b = copysign(isinf(__b) ? 1.0 : 0.0, __b); + __real__ z = INFINITY * (__a * __c + __b * __d); + __imag__ z = INFINITY * (__b * __c - __a * __d); + } + else if (isinf(__logbw) && __logbw > 0.0 && isfinite(__a) && isfinite(__b)) + { + __c = copysign(isinf(__c) ? 1.0 : 0.0, __c); + __d = copysign(isinf(__d) ? 1.0 : 0.0, __d); + __real__ z = 0.0 * (__a * __c + __b * __d); + __imag__ z = 0.0 * (__b * __c - __a * __d); + } + } + return z; +} |
